Danger and Rescue
When he speaks to her, his tone is gentle and calm. But in the ten years they've known each other, Sakura has learned to read him.
Kakashi is not calm. He is furious. Furious at her for disobeying his order to stand down, for blindly attempting to take on the enemy without knowing what she was up against. He is furious at her for being captured.
But, if their severed limbs are any indication, Kakashi is more enraged with the enemy nin who took her. The grass is stained red, and forty pairs of eyes see no more.
Still, when he speaks to her, he sounds composed. In control. "Can you hear me, Sakura?" he asks slowly. He brushes a few pink strands away from her face, smearing the blood she knows is there. "Do you understand me?"
She wants to tell him yes, of course she understands him, because she is Sakura and he is Kakashi and despite what he says she understands what he means, understands what his uncovered eye is telling her. She understands that his fury is fueled by his terror. She understands that he can't go through this again, can't watch another person close to him fade away while he continues to live.
She wants to tell him that she's sorry.
But it's hard to breathe because she's drowning and the only thing that bubbles from her lips is more blood.
He shushes her, keeps smoothing down her hair. "Don't waste your energy. Sakura, you have internal bleeding. You have to heal yourself."
She knows she does, but she is just so tired and she wants to take a nap and she can feel that it is all futile anyway. And so can the ninken, because Bisuke hasn't stopped whining since he found her and Pakkun keeps snuffling in her hair and Shiba keeps pacing and the others just look at her with sad eyes.
But Kakashi refuses to see it, refuses to give up. So, for him, she allows her hands to glow green.
And when they stop, too tired to do any more, his inexperienced hands take their place.
